Description
【発明の詳細な説明】
この発明は飼料、調味料、栄養補強剤等の製造
法に関するものである。D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a method for producing feeds, seasonings, nutritional supplements, etc.
従来、飼料、調味料、栄養補強剤その他肥料等
を製造するに際して、動物、魚介類、羽毛等の原
料の乾燥処理物を使用することは通常行われてい
るが、悪臭を含んでおり、人間の食用に供するの
に難点があり、また、原料にはそれぞれ特有の含
有成分を有しているので、互いに一長一短の有効
成分があり、互いに補完した状態での処理が行わ
れていなかつた。 Conventionally, when manufacturing feed, seasonings, nutritional supplements, and other fertilizers, it has been common practice to use dried raw materials such as animals, seafood, and feathers, but they contain bad odors and are harmful to humans. In addition, since each raw material has its own unique ingredients, each has its own advantages and disadvantages in terms of active ingredients, and processing has not been carried out in a manner that complements each other.
この発明では、とくに、羽毛と、魚介類との原
料の特有成分を互いに補完して、最終処理製品と
しては、必須アミノ酸の相互補完ができ、有効な
飼料、調味料、栄養補強剤に使用できるこれらの
製造法を提供せんとするものである。 In this invention, in particular, the unique components of the raw materials of feathers and seafood can be complemented with each other, and the final processed product can complement each other with essential amino acids, and can be used as an effective feed, seasoning, and nutritional supplement. The present invention aims to provide a method for producing these.
この発明の実施例において、栄養補強剤につい
て詳説すれば、原料としては、羽毛と魚介類を使
用するものであり、羽毛は、クツカー中に収納し
て密閉し、クツカーのジヤケツト部に加熱蒸気を
圧入して30〜60分間、120℃〜160℃の条件下で蒸
煮するものであり、かかる蒸煮処理によつて羽毛
を加水分解処理した後に、加水分解処理の羽毛
と、魚介類とを同時に油収納クツカー中に投入し
て油中に浸漬する。 In the embodiments of this invention, the nutritional supplement is explained in detail. Feathers and seafood are used as raw materials. The feathers are stored in a couture and sealed, and heated steam is applied to the jacket of the couture. The feathers are press-fitted and steamed for 30 to 60 minutes at a temperature of 120 to 160 degrees Celsius.After the feathers are hydrolyzed through this steaming process, the hydrolyzed feathers and seafood are simultaneously heated in oil. Place it in a storage bag and soak it in oil.
なお、羽毛の加水分解処理したクツカー中に魚
介類と油とを投入してもよい。 Incidentally, seafood and oil may be added to a couture made of hydrolyzed feathers.
また、油は動物油又は、植物油を使用する。 In addition, animal oil or vegetable oil is used as the oil.
油収納のクツカーのジヤケツトには、加熱蒸気
を圧入し、油を約80℃〜120℃前後に加熱し、約
3時間で油温によつて、羽毛と魚介類の脱水処理
を行う。 Heated steam is injected into the jacket of the oil storage jacket to heat the oil to about 80°C to 120°C, and the feathers and seafood are dehydrated in about 3 hours depending on the temperature of the oil.
クツカー中では、油温による加熱処理中に、撹
拌羽根により、羽毛、魚介類の撹拌混合を行つて
おり、油中では、加水分解処理された羽毛と魚介
類とが、粉砕混合されながら、油の浸透により、
芯部に至るまで完全脱水され、含水率約6%前後
となる。 In the cutter, feathers and seafood are stirred and mixed by a stirring blade during heat treatment at oil temperature. In the oil, the hydrolyzed feathers and seafood are crushed and mixed while Due to the penetration of
It is completely dehydrated down to the core, with a moisture content of approximately 6%.
また、本発明では、油温脱水時にクツカー中を
減圧していき、とくに原料投入後約30分間の初期
の少ない減圧(絶対圧約700〜750mmHg)と、後
期の大きな減圧(ほぼ真空状態)との二段階減圧
を行うことにより、有効な脱水処理及び後工程の
搾油処理の効率化をはかりうる。 In addition, in the present invention, the pressure inside the cupper is reduced during oil temperature dehydration, and in particular, the initial small pressure reduction (absolute pressure of about 700 to 750 mmHg) about 30 minutes after inputting the raw materials, and the late large pressure reduction (almost a vacuum state). By performing two-stage depressurization, effective dehydration treatment and efficiency of oil extraction treatment in the subsequent process can be achieved.
かかる2段階減圧の下に、減圧初期において
は、油温と小さい減圧条件とによつて、まず、魚
介類の水溶性蛋白質及びゼラチン質を凝固安定化
せしめ、これらの呈味成分の流出・分解を防止
し、これら呈味成分流出に伴う脂肪・ビタミン類
の流出をも防止することができる。 Under such two-stage depressurization, in the early stage of decompression, water-soluble proteins and gelatin of seafood are first coagulated and stabilized by oil temperature and small decompression conditions, and these flavor components are prevented from flowing out and decomposing. It is also possible to prevent the outflow of fats and vitamins accompanying the outflow of these taste components.
一方、減圧後期における大きな減圧条件によつ
て、原料に含まれる水分を蒸散せしめつつ、原料
組織中で同水分と加熱油との置換を行い、加熱油
を原料組織中に深く浸透させて、組織内外からの
原料を加熱油を熱媒体として加熱し、短時間での
脱水処理が可能となる。 On the other hand, due to the large decompression conditions in the latter half of decompression, the water contained in the raw material is evaporated and replaced with the heated oil in the raw material structure, allowing the heated oil to deeply penetrate into the raw material structure and By heating raw materials from inside and outside using heated oil as a heat medium, it is possible to dehydrate them in a short time.
次いで、クツカー中より原料を取出して、圧搾
機にかけて搾油し、ノーマルヘキサン等の脱油剤
で脱油し、粉抹状とする。 Next, the raw material is taken out from the kukka, pressed into a press to extract the oil, and is deoiled with an oil removing agent such as normal hexane to form powder.
この粉抹状の製品は、栄養補強剤として飲用す
るものである。 This powdered product is intended for drinking as a nutritional supplement.
また、上記栄養補強剤の製造方法と同様の方法
によつて加水分解した羽毛と魚介類とから粉抹状
の製品を製造し、飼料、あるいは調味料として使
用することもできる。 In addition, a powder-like product can be produced from hydrolyzed feathers and seafood by a method similar to the method for producing the above-mentioned nutritional supplement, and used as feed or seasoning.
この発明では、羽毛を予め加水分解処理してい
るので、羽毛に含有された蛋白質は分解されてお
り、しかも可溶性となつており、これに魚介類を
混合して油温により2段階減圧の下で脱水処理す
るため、相互の原料のアミノ酸バランスを改善
し、とくに、魚介類に乏しい、シスチン等が、魚
介類のエキス成分、すなわちエキス窒素、アミノ
窒素と混合されることになり、しかも、羽毛、魚
介類に特有の悪臭も、油温による加熱処理の際に
油によつて消臭されて、最終製品に悪臭が一残存
することなく、羽毛、及び魚介類の各々の必須ア
ミノ酸が補完しあつて、良好なアミノ酸含有製品
とすることができ、味覚、栄養バランスの上で
も、有効な製品とすることができる効果がある。 In this invention, since the feathers are hydrolyzed in advance, the proteins contained in the feathers have been decomposed and are soluble, and seafood is mixed with this and the mixture is heated under two-step vacuum depending on the oil temperature. As the dehydration treatment is carried out, the amino acid balance of each raw material is improved, and in particular, cystine, which is lacking in seafood, is mixed with the extract components of seafood, namely extract nitrogen and amino nitrogen. The odor peculiar to seafood is deodorized by the oil during heat treatment at oil temperature, and the essential amino acids of each of the feathers and seafood are supplemented without leaving any bad odor in the final product. As a result, a product containing good amino acids can be obtained, and the product can be effective in terms of taste and nutritional balance.
